Класс PublisherMonitor
Monitors a replication Publisher.
Иерархия наследования
System.Object
Microsoft.SqlServer.Replication.ReplicationObject
Microsoft.SqlServer.Replication.PublisherMonitor
Пространство имен: Microsoft.SqlServer.Replication
Сборка: Microsoft.SqlServer.Rmo (в Microsoft.SqlServer.Rmo.dll)
Синтаксис
'Декларация
Public NotInheritable Class PublisherMonitor _
Inherits ReplicationObject
'Применение
Dim instance As PublisherMonitor
public sealed class PublisherMonitor : ReplicationObject
public ref class PublisherMonitor sealed : public ReplicationObject
[<SealedAttribute>]
type PublisherMonitor =
class
inherit ReplicationObject
end
public final class PublisherMonitor extends ReplicationObject
Тип PublisherMonitor обеспечивает доступ к следующим элементам.
Конструкторы
Имя | Описание | |
---|---|---|
PublisherMonitor() | Creates a new instance of the PublisherMonitor class. | |
PublisherMonitor(String, ServerConnection) | Creates a new instance of the PublisherMonitor class with the specified name and a connection to the Distributor. |
В начало
Свойства
Имя | Описание | |
---|---|---|
CachePropertyChanges | Gets or sets whether to cache changes made to the replication properties or to apply them immediately. (Производный от ReplicationObject.) | |
CacheRefreshPolicy | Инфраструктура. Gets or sets the monitor cache refresh policy. | |
ConnectionContext | Gets or sets the connection to an instance of Microsoft SQL Server. (Производный от ReplicationObject.) | |
DistributionDatabase | Gets the name of the distribution database used by the Publisher. | |
ExcludeAnonymousSubscriptions | Gets whether or not information on anonymous subscriptions is returned. | |
IsExistingObject | Gets whether the object exists on the server or not. (Производный от ReplicationObject.) | |
Name | Gets the name of the Publisher. | |
PublicationMonitors | Represents a collection of PublicationMonitor objects, each of which represents a publication defined at the Publisher being monitored. | |
PublisherType | Gets the type of the database server that is the Publisher. | |
SqlServerName | Gets the name of the Microsoft SQL Server instance to which this object is connected. (Производный от ReplicationObject.) | |
StatusAndWarning | Gets status information and warnings for the monitored threshold metrics on the Publisher. | |
UserData | Gets or sets an object property that allows users to attach their own data to the object. (Производный от ReplicationObject.) |
В начало
Методы
Имя | Описание | |
---|---|---|
CommitPropertyChanges | Sends all the cached property change statements to the instance of Microsoft SQL Server. (Производный от ReplicationObject.) | |
Decouple | Decouples the referenced replication object from the server. (Производный от ReplicationObject.) | |
EnumDatabasePublications | Returns information about publications that use a specified publication database. | |
EnumDatabaseSubscriptions | Returns information on subscriptions that belong to publications that use a specified publication database. | |
EnumDistributionAgentSessionDetails | Returns detailed information about a Distribution Agent session. | |
EnumDistributionAgentSessions | Returns information about Distribution Agent sessions. | |
EnumErrorRecords | Returns information on errors associated with a specified error ID that occurred during a synchronization session. | |
EnumLogReaderAgentSessionDetails | Returns detailed information about a Log Reader Agent session. | |
EnumLogReaderAgentSessions | Returns information about Log Reader Agent sessions. | |
EnumMergeAgentSessionDetails | Returns detailed information about a Merge Agent session. | |
EnumMergeAgentSessionDetails2 | Returns additional detailed information about a Merge Agent session. | |
EnumMergeAgentSessions | Returns information about Merge Agent sessions. | |
EnumMergeAgentSessions2 | Returns additional information about Merge Agent sessions. | |
EnumPublications | Returns information on publications at a monitored Publisher. | |
EnumPublications2 | Returns additional information on publications at a monitored Publisher. | |
EnumSnapshotAgentSessionDetails | Returns detailed information about a Snapshot Agent session. | |
EnumSnapshotAgentSessions | Returns information about Snapshot Agent sessions. | |
EnumSubscriptions | Returns information about subscriptions that belong to a publication at the monitored Publisher. | |
Equals | (Производный от Object.) | |
GetHashCode | (Производный от Object.) | |
GetType | (Производный от Object.) | |
Load | Loads the properties of an existing object from the server. (Производный от ReplicationObject.) | |
LoadProperties | Loads the properties of an existing object from the server. (Производный от ReplicationObject.) | |
Refresh | Reloads the properties of the object. (Производный от ReplicationObject.) | |
ToString | (Производный от Object.) |
В начало
Замечания
Any method of PublisherMonitor will throw an exception if the Distributor is not installed and the distribution database does not exist.
Thread Safety
Any public static (Shared in Microsoft Visual Basic) members of this type are safe for multithreaded operations. Any instance members are not guaranteed to be thread safe.
Безопасность многопоточности
Любые открытые статический (Shared в Visual Basic) элементы этого типа потокобезопасны. Потокобезопасность с элементами экземпляров не гарантируется.
См. также
Справочник
Пространство имен Microsoft.SqlServer.Replication
Другие ресурсы
Наблюдение за репликацией программным образом (программирование объектов RMO)